Our Partners

Arts Kentucky works most closely with three important partners:
The Kentucky Arts Council, a state agency in the Commerce Cabinet, provides operational support funding for Arts Kentucky with state tax dollars. This funding supports educational workshops and trainings, communication and resource awareness initiatives, and networking among artists and arts groups across the state.

Americans for the Arts is the nation's leading nonprofit organization for advancing the arts in America. With 45 years of service, they represent and serve local communities, while creating opportunities for every American to participate in and appreciate all forms of the arts. AFTA's State Arts Action Network creates links between Arts Kentucky and other statewide organizations like it across the nation, and these collaborative partners create regular learning opportunities for each other that advance our common goals.
The National Endowment for the Arts provides both direct and indirect funding for Arts Kentucky, through their funding of the Kentucky Arts Council and through direct grants for arts education programs.

The NEA is a public agency dedicated to supporting excellence in the arts, both new and established; bringing the arts to all Americans; and providing leadership in arts education. Established by Congress in 1965 as an independent agency of the federal government, the Endowment is the nation's largest annual funder of the arts, bringing great art to all 50 states, including rural areas, inner cities, and military bases.
